Quote:
Originally Posted by wtwo3 View Post
I live in the western suburbs of Chicago. When it comes to the city, stay in the major touristy areas and you'll be totally fine. Millennium park/Michigan Ave/Navy Pier are all relatively safe spots. It's when you get to the South side of Chicago that things start to really get hairy.
So no self guided tour down Halsted?

OP, the South and West sides....NOGO. The places you mentioned should be fine. Yeah, there has been aome hooliganism around Michigan Ave at times but just be aware of your surroundings. It's wide open there ao not too hard to see around you.

If you take 290 straight in, it'll take you straight to Michigan Ave and you can park at Millenium Park (if you like easy). There are also plenty of other self parking garages, too. If you take 90 in, exit off at Ohio and go straight up from there.
